Commercial director David King to leave Alpha Airports
Airline caterer Alpha Airports has announced that commercial director David King will leave the company.
The move is part of a restructure designed to "better align the business with the needs of its customers".
As a result of the changes, Alpha's retail and catering divisions will now have their own commercial departments that will look after buying, food development and merchandise management.
Alpha chief executive and chairman Peter Williams said: "We are very grateful to David who has brought a wealth of experience over the six years he has been working for Alpha."
He added: "The restructuring will bring far greater focus and clarity to our two operational divisions."
